Brief Summary

The purpose of this trial is to determine if combination therapy with rosiglitazone and bexarotene might have a synergistic effect in the treatment of patients with CTCL.

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Patients with biopsy proven persistent or recurrent cutaneous cell lymphoma (CTCL) Stage IA-IVA
  • Patients with a pathologic proven diagnosis of CTCL that is documented in the patient history.
  • Patient has preserved organ function.
  • Patient has an ECOG performance status between 0 - 2.
  • Women of childbearing potential should be screened for pregnancy prior to treatment and utilize effective contraceptive methods (e.g. barrier) during treatment period.
  • Patients over the age of 18 who are willing and able to provide Informed Consent
  • The patient has been taking Targretin capsules for at least the last 4 months and the dose has remained relatively stable.
  • The patient has had stable or progressive disease over the past 4 months.
  • Patient has adequate laboratory parameters for liver and kidney function.

Exclusion

  • Patients with CD30+ Anaplastic Large Cell Lymphoma
  • Patients with pathology consistent with peripheral T-cell lymphoma.
  • Patients with Stage IVB (visceral involvement with CTCL).
  • Patients with history of Human Immunodeficiency Virus (HIV), Hepatitis B or Hepatitis C infection.
  • Patients with a diagnosis of congestive heart failure.
  • Patients exhibiting significant edema or unstable cardiovascular disease.
  • Patients with a fasting triglyceride level greater then 500mg/dl.
  • Patients that have started any new treatment for CTCL in the past 4 months.
  • Pregnant women will be excluded from the study.
